int CountArgs(char *line)
/* Count args from input line (from SAS Source: _main.c) */
{
    char *argbuf;
    int argc;

   argbuf = line;
   for (argc = 0; ; argc++)
   {
        while (isspace(*line))  line++;
        if (*line == '\0')      break;
        if (*line == QUOTE)
        {
            line++;
            while (*line != QUOTE && *line != 0)
            {
               if (*line == ESCAPE)
               {
                  line++;
                  if (*line == 0) break;
               }
               line++;
            }
            if (*line) line++;
        }
        else            /* non-quoted arg */
        {
            while ((*line != '\0') && (!isspace(*line))) line++;
            if (*line == '\0')  break;
        }
   }
   return argc;
}

char **CreateArgArray(char *line,int argc)
/*
** Build argument pointer array from input line and argument numnergs argc
** (from SAS Source: _main.c)
*/
{
    char *argbuf,**argv;
    int i;

   argv = AllocVec((argc+1) * sizeof(char *), MEMF_CLEAR);
   if (argv == NULL)
   CloseAll(20);

   i = 0;
   argbuf=line;

   while (1)
   {
       while (isspace(*line))  line++;
       if (*line == '\0')      break;
       if (*line == QUOTE)
       {
           argbuf = argv[i++] = ++line;  /* ptr inside quoted string */
           while (*line != QUOTE && *line != 0)
           {
              if (*line == ESCAPE)
              {
                 line++;
                 switch (*line)
                 {
                    case '\0':
                       *argbuf = 0;
                       goto linedone;
                    case 'E':
                       *argbuf++ = ESC;
                       break;
                    case 'N':
                       *argbuf++ = NL;
                       break;
                    default:
                       *argbuf++ = *line;
                 }
                 line++;
              }
              else
              {
                *argbuf++ = *line++;
              }
           }
           if (*line) line++;
           *argbuf++ = '\0'; /* terminate arg */
       }
       else            /* non-quoted arg */
       {
           argv[i++] = line;
           while ((*line != '\0') && (!isspace(*line))) line++;
           if (*line == '\0')  break;
           else                *line++ = '\0';  /* terminate arg */
       }
   }
linedone:
   return argv;
}
